    This was a nice old time diner that I enjoyed a quick lunch at while in town on business. You feel like you're transported back in time with how the features have been reserved, but not in a run down way. The servers were quick to get me seated, watered and waited on. I enjoyed a hot turkey sandwich and upgraded my side salad to their cashew salad which added a little extra to it. Enjoyed my meal. Wouldn't mind coming again.

    This place has been a staple location since I moved to Salinas. They are more of a local joint with a basic comfort meal menu. I ordered Chicken Fried Steak with eggs over medium. It was okay, it seemed to lack a bit of flavor and the gravy need a bit of salt. Pretty much standard diner. The coffee tastes like Farmer Bros. so it is just okay. My server was prompt since I sat at the counter to order. I don't recall that she mentioned any specials, eh. The restaurant needs a refresh. it is spacious with two rooms to sit in. There are about 4 or 5 counter seats near the front.

    A local tradition in old town Salinas, Dudley's offers breakfast and lunch comfort foods in a friendly atmosphere. Check out the Daily Double or the tuna melt. Lucy and the other waitstaff are always friendly and supply coffee refills at perfect intervals. Dudley's is convenient to businesses, government offices, and our tourist hub near the Steinbeck Center.

    Old town feel. If you like old school diners without much flare but kind service this is the spot. Good array of options from sandwiches, burgers, and breakfast omelettes. I'm from Marina and moved to Salinas. We use to go to this spot in Marina for locals breakfast. This feels like it. We ordered the Phoenix (bacon avocado, tomato, cheese) and good fries and quiche with potatoes and fruit. Solid breakfast spot and easy to pay. Will come back for sure. The people upfront the two ladies were amazing and great service.

    Dudley's is a breakfast/lunch spot in oldtown Salinas. Has that classic American diner feel. Ordered: Coffee & The Yahoo! Omelet (w/ Ortega Chilles & mushrooms) The omelet was good. Fresh tasting and the chilles & mushrooms sautéed well. Country potatoes were excellent. I ordered coffee and asked for half and half. I got oil-based creamer instead... not good. Price: $21 (Meal cost: $16.93)
